In pharmaceutical R&D, scientist time is one of the most valuable resources in the laboratory. Yet in many high throughput drug discovery and immunology research workflows, colony picking remains a manual bottleneck.
Identifying, imaging and extracting individual colonies from Petri dishes and bioassay trays requires significant operator time. When colonies need to be transferred from multiple source tray locations into 96- or 384-well microplates, the process becomes labour-intensive, variability-prone and difficult to scale.
The K8 automated colony picking system from Kbiosystems removes this bottleneck. The system delivers picking accuracy of more than 98.5%, supported by USB3 camera imaging and full positional feedback. It also handles a wide range of source and destination formats.
For one global pharmaceutical R&D team, the requirement went beyond standard automation. Regional picking zones and control clone positions specific to the team’s plate layout needed to be integrated before the system arrived. Kbiosystems delivered that configuration before installation, ensuring the K8 was aligned with the laboratory’s workflow from day one.
